    Sniffer4J

    Sniffer4J

    A java packet sniffer and forger that wraps pcap libs.

    Sniffer4J is a java packet capture and manipulation tool that allows full analysis of a network. It is built upon pcap libs (winpcap, and libpcap) and can run in Windows and most Linux flavors. The current stable version (2.0) provides shared libraries (.dll and .SO) compiled and tested for both x86 and x64 architectures. Sniffer4J work’s by parsing packets in a comprehensive Pdu format.
